sql如何选择服务器类型
-
答:在选择SQL服务器类型时,有几个因素需要考虑。这些因素包括:预算、性能需求、可用性、扩展性和管理复杂性等。
首先,预算是选择服务器类型时首要考虑的因素之一。根据预算的大小,可以选择不同的服务器类型,如共享主机、虚拟私有服务器(VPS)或独立服务器。共享主机是最便宜的选择,但性能和资源可能会受限制。VPS和独立服务器则提供更高的性能和资源,但价格也相应较高。
其次,性能需求是选择服务器类型时需要考虑的重要因素。根据应用程序的性能需求,可以选择不同的服务器类型。例如,对于小型网站或低流量的应用,共享主机可能已经足够。而对于大型网站或高流量的应用,可能需要更高性能的VPS或独立服务器。
另外,可用性也是选择服务器类型时需要考虑的因素之一。如果应用程序对可用性要求较高,例如需要7×24小时的运行,那么可以考虑选择具有冗余和备份功能的服务器类型,以确保在发生故障时能够快速恢复。
此外,扩展性也是选择服务器类型时需要考虑的因素之一。如果应用程序预计会有较大的增长和流量增加,那么需要选择具有良好扩展性的服务器类型,以便能够轻松地添加更多的资源和服务器节点。
最后,管理复杂性也是选择服务器类型时需要考虑的一个因素。不同类型的服务器需要不同程度的配置和管理工作,因此需要根据自己的技术能力和资源来选择合适的服务器类型。共享主机通常具有最低的管理复杂性,而独立服务器则需要更多的管理工作。
综上所述,选择SQL服务器类型需要综合考虑预算、性能需求、可用性、扩展性和管理复杂性等因素。根据这些因素的权衡,选择适合自己应用程序需求的服务器类型。
1年前 -
选择适合的服务器类型对于SQL数据库的性能和可靠性非常重要。以下是选择SQL服务器类型的几个关键因素:
-
数据库负载:首先需要了解数据库的负载情况,即数据库需要处理多少并发连接、读写请求的数量和频率以及数据量的大小。根据负载情况,可以选择单节点服务器、集群服务器、分布式服务器等。
-
硬件要求:数据库的性能和可靠性取决于服务器的硬件资源,如处理器、内存、硬盘和网络带宽。根据数据库负载和性能需求,选择具备足够硬件资源的服务器类型,如独立服务器、虚拟服务器或云服务器。
-
可用性要求:对于需要高可用性的应用,应选择具备故障恢复和故障转移能力的服务器类型。例如,选择具备热备份和自动故障转移功能的服务器类型,以确保数据的可靠性和持续可用性。
-
数据库管理和监控需求:根据数据库管理和监控的需求选择相应的服务器类型。一些服务器类型提供了强大的数据库管理和监控工具,可以简化日常管理和监控任务,提升数据库的性能和可靠性。
-
预算:最后,还需要考虑预算因素。不同类型的服务器具有不同的价格和费用模型。根据预算限制选择适合的服务器类型,例如选择云服务器可以根据实际使用情况灵活调整成本。
总结:选择适合的SQL服务器类型需要综合考虑数据库负载、硬件要求、可用性要求、数据库管理和监控需求以及预算等因素。根据具体需求选择单节点服务器、集群服务器、分布式服务器等,并确保服务器具备足够的硬件资源和故障恢复能力,以提升数据库的性能和可靠性。
1年前 -
-
选择适当的服务器类型是建立和维护一个高效、可靠的数据库系统的关键步骤之一。以下是选择SQL服务器类型时应该考虑的一些方法和操作流程:
-
定义需求和目标:
在选择适当的服务器类型之前,首先要明确数据库系统的需求和目标。这包括数据量、并发连接数、性能要求等方面。根据这些需求和目标,可以更准确地选择服务器类型。 -
考虑硬件要求:
不同的服务器类型对硬件要求有所不同。在选择服务器类型之前,需要考虑数据库系统所需的硬件资源,如处理器、内存、存储等。确定这些硬件要求后,可以进一步缩小服务器类型的选择范围。 -
评估数据存储需求:
数据库系统的数据存储需求也是选择服务器类型的重要考虑因素之一。根据数据库的大小和增长趋势,可以决定是否需要使用磁盘阵列或网络存储等扩展存储解决方案。 -
比较不同的服务器类型:
根据前面几个步骤的结果,可以通过比较不同的服务器类型来选择最适合的一个。可以考虑的服务器类型包括传统的物理服务器、虚拟化服务器和云服务器等。比较不同的服务器类型时,需要考虑到硬件成本、性能、可用性、扩展性等方面。 -
选择供应商和操作系统:
根据选择的服务器类型,可以进一步选择合适的供应商和操作系统。不同的供应商提供不同的硬件和软件解决方案,而不同的操作系统也会对系统性能和稳定性产生影响。因此,在选择供应商和操作系统时需要综合考虑这些因素。 -
配置和部署服务器:
一旦选择了合适的服务器类型、供应商和操作系统,就可以开始配置和部署服务器。这包括选择合适的硬件配置、安装操作系统和数据库软件、进行系统优化等。配置和部署服务器需要根据厂商提供的文档和最佳实践指南进行操作。 -
进行性能测试和优化:
在服务器配置和部署完成后,还需要进行性能测试和优化,以确保数据库系统能够满足预期的性能要求。性能测试包括负载测试、压力测试等,通过监控和调整数据库系统的各个组件来优化系统性能。
总结:
选择适当的SQL服务器类型是一个复杂的过程,需要考虑多个因素。通过明确需求和目标、评估硬件要求和数据存储需求、比较不同的服务器类型、选择合适的供应商和操作系统、配置和部署服务器以及进行性能测试和优化,可以选择到最适合的SQL服务器类型。1年前 -